New Aussie
G'day ,
Been reading on the forum for a while so thought to say g'day and learn from all you blokes.
I'm looking very hard at getting into an R8 pro success. Based in brisbane my biggest hurdle is finding a store that stock them as i would love to handle a pro success just to ensure the LOP will be correct and the gun will fit me properly and to tell myself why i need one in my life.
I am finding it hard to let go of few sako's to fund this purchase but i am sure i will get more comfortable once i find a R8 pro success to play with.
If any blokes are based in brisbane and would allow me to have a play with their R8 pro success i would be much appreciated.
Cheers and Happy Australia Day

Re: New Aussie
Welcome.
LOP wise blasers are very long. The synthetic stocks are available to order from Blaser with various LOPs. It may be worth investigating this before you commit. Special order may add a bit of time but would be worth it to get it right

Re: New Aussie
The Blaser configurator was not loading for me for some weird reason but i finally go onto it today and i did see that the LOP of the pro success is plenty enough. At 370mm it is longet then the LOP of my sako bavarian which is at 355.
Since it is a 370mm i will have to do a special order with an LOP of 355mm
I have always had rifles with the hogsback stock so hoping the pro success will suit me
